#2d732a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2d732a is composed of 17.6% red, 45.1% green and 16.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 63.5%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 117.5 degrees, a saturation of 46.5% and a lightness of 30.8%. #2d732a color hex could be obtained by blending #5ae654 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#2d732a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f1faf1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2d732a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4e4f4e is the less saturated color, while #0c9706 is the most saturated one.
